Iran is in the midst of the most significant protest movement in years — and it is being lead by women and girls.

The spark that ignited this movement was the murder of 22 year old Mahsa Amini, who had been arrested by Iran's morality police for improperly wearing her headscarf. She was beaten to death in police custody.

Protests erupted throughout the country, with women and school aged girls audaciously flaunting laws around dress codes. It is a feminist led uprising against the ultra-conservative government lead by Ebrahim Raisi and, as some argue, against the Islamic revolutionary system that has governed Iran since 1979.

In this episode, we are joined by Negar Mortazavi, an Iranian-American journalist and commentator and host of the Iran Podcast. We discuss how these protests started and then spread to become an intersectional movement. We then have an in-depth conversation about the Iranian government's response and what may come next.
